Cask at CBC Clerko, 24/04/17. Clear golden with a well appointed off white head that retains well. Nose is juicy citric peel, melon, light pine, orange pith, soft bread. Taste comprises mango, pithy citrics, hint of red grapefruit, toasted grains, soft bread, melon. Medium bodied, soft carbonation, semi drying close spiked with juicy hop bitterness. Solid cask APA.

Cask at CBC Clerks - London. Pours clear, pale yellow with a creamy, white head. The nose holds melon, ripe lemon, hay, pale malts. Light sweet flavour with further melon, pineapple, grapefruit, light rindy and grassy bitterness. Light bodied with fine carbonation; decent condition. Nicely balanced finish, more pineapple, some peach, pale bread, mild grass. Nice one.

(Cask at King William IV, Leyton, London, 10 Apr 2014) Golden yellow colour with foamy, white head. Fruity, hoppy nose with notes of citrus, resin and lots of fresh hops. Fruity, hoppy taste with citrus, grapefruit, lemon peel, resin and a generous, fresh, resiny bitterness in the finish. Medium body, with balanced sweetness. Very fresh and tasty, with a generous hop character. Very nice.
